What's Happening?
Hungary has announced the shutdown of its only nuclear power plant, the Paks Nuclear Power Plant, due to record-low water levels in the Danube River, which are insufficient for cooling the plant's reactors. Prime Minister Peter Magyar stated that the plant, which provides
nearly half of Hungary's electricity, will be powered down for the first time in its 44-year history. The plant's output had already decreased significantly, dropping from a normal 2,000 megawatts to just 240 megawatts. The Danube's water level at Paks has fallen to minus 134cm, necessitating the shutdown, with levels expected to drop further. This situation is part of a broader climate crisis affecting Europe, with heatwaves and droughts impacting multiple sectors, including shipping, tourism, agriculture, and industry.
